Lack of Movement - Should I be concerned?

I woke up last Wednesday unable to breathe and went to the hospital. Ended up with a virus or something and have been incredibly sick since. The baby looked great. I didn't go to my NST on Friday because I've been horribly ill. LO didn't seem to mind and has actually been way more active than normal. That is until today. It's been a number of hours and I haven't really felt her move. I don't want to freak out for no reason but it's starting to make me nervous and I feel like it's my fault because I couldn't go to my NST. I'm kind of scared my violent coughing has hurt something in there. I know that sounds silly but it's been kind of awful, and my whole abdomen hurts from it. I really, really don't want to go to the hospital for the fourth time just to be told she's fine. What can I do to try to wake her up before I call??

  • Mine have been off and on, somedays they are quiet and it does concern me. Try drinking some juice/ gatorade and laying on your left side and wait about 10 min and see if LO moves. I was sick with norovirus last week and the day I got better they were moving like nuts! I notice movement at least twice a day for long periods of time, I know that they are now sleeping longer according to my "what to expect" book. I have an NST tomorrow and had a growth u/s Friday with biophysicals so I know they did ok. If your LO doesn't move within an hour of doing the juice laying down then give the doc a call and tell them your concern. Mine also have certain personalities (my girl is more quiet so I know what is "normal" for her, although my boy has been somewhat more quiet recently but I know he can't move much now!!)

    Never hurts to call though!! Hugs!!

  • As you know, I went in a few weeks ago for lack of movement and there he was bouncing all over.  The nurse gave me a great suggestion ... stick an ice pack on your belly.  Leave it there for a little bit and she will feel the cold and move away from it.

    Lay on your left side, drink something cold and sugary. 

    She may also just be having a more quiet day since she was so busy over the weekend with all the coughing, etc.

    If nothing works, I'm a firm believer in go be checked for your own sanity. :)
